I started with an image from the Bare Bottoms folder on my
Shameless Hussies 1 CD.
(Those images are copyright-free and in the public domain.)
Over this, I placed a new photo of the moon, from PDPhoto.org. I actually used that image twice on
each panel: Once, small and exactly as it appears at PDPhoto.org; the second time I enlarged it to the size
of the card and inverted the color in Adobe Photoshop.
On top of the darker moon image, I applied some text and imagery from an old Alchemy book that I own.
After flipping the image and altering the color, I added text in the
Rudelsberg Regular font. Then,
I filled in the background with a copyright-free flower image from PDPhoto.org, and altered the colors to match
the card.
